Digital Desk: A SpiceJet flight from Jeddah (Saudi Arabia) bound for Kozhikode with 197 passengers and six crew members on board made an emergency landing at the Cochin International Airport Limited (CIAL) on Friday evening due to hydraulic failure, said an airport spokesperson.

An emergency was declared at the airport at 6:29 pm after the SpiceJet-SG 036 flight, which was due to land at Kozhikode airport, was diverted to Kochi, he said.

"A full emergency was declared at Kochi airport at 18:29 hours. The flight landed safely at 19.19 hours on the runway following an emergency landing situation," he added.
